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
595210119 2005027643 57846914
600893 9743361521 39544276
600893 9743361521 39544276
90 850758 902713929
All about undefined
Interested in learning more?
600893 9743361521 39544276
90 850758 902713929
See more
914 44927021 61843339253
45 882070 2846053613
See more
231 02225662118
5723485239 87237746 47558179183
See more